Output 0edeaa50265393cc75d7f14ee1856abf6b514b3efb24b5898e2aa3c30ef3ebd8:0

value
23525953
script pubkey
OP_0 OP_PUSHBYTES_20 5e31fd359c684d5e8c27727d4dd5da78aaca4580
address
bc1qtccl6dvudpx4arp8wf75m4w60z4v53vqyuv59y
transaction
0edeaa50265393cc75d7f14ee1856abf6b514b3efb24b5898e2aa3c30ef3ebd8
spent
true